Hyderabad is the biryani capital of India. The city has many well-known places and popular restaurants that serve the famous Hyderabadi biryani with pride. Hyderabad chicken biryani was invented by the chefs in the Nizam’s kitchen in the mid-18th century. And it’s now known and loved all over the world. Slow-cooked rice, tender chicken (or veggies if you prefer that life), flavourful spices – it’s like the best things in the world on a single plate.

Paradise is one of Hyderabad’s most iconic biryani chains, with several branches across the city. Many people believe it’s overhyped now, and honestly, that’s true. However, it’s still a good place to start if you’re new to the city. The biryani is lighter than others, not too spicy and not too oily. Their dining area is clean and comfortable. The Chicken Biryani with salan and raita is the classic combo here. It might not amaze you, but it won’t let you down, either.

Bawarchi is famous for its aromatic and flavorful mutton and chicken biryanis. One of the most popular places in Hyderabad is known for good reasons. The biryani here is full of flavour and comes in large portions. It’s a little spicy, so prepare for that. The restaurant is always crowded, and finding parking can be tough. However, once you try the biryani, you’ll forget all about the hassle. Try the Bawarchi Special Biryani. You won’t regret it.

Meridian Biryani in Punjagutta is known for its balanced flavours and excellent spice mix. Their mutton biryani is very famous in Hyderabad and is packed with bold spices like cumin, cloves, and cinnamon. Just the smell will make you hungry. It’s a great spot for comforting and rich food. One of Hyderabad’s oldest biryani spots, Grand Hotel in Abids, serves traditional mutton dum biryani along with other classic dishes. It is known for its generous portions and genuine flavour. It remains a favourite for anyone looking for an authentic biryani experience. This place is great if you want something simple, affordable, and open almost all day. It’s not fancy, but the food is genuine comfort food. The biryani is quite spicy. The atmosphere is casual, and you’ll find a mix of college students, families, and regulars.

Located in Ghansi Bazaar, Hotel Shadab is one of the most famous biryani spots near the historic Charminar. As soon as you walk into the restaurant, the aroma of ghee, spices, and slow-cooked meat greets you. The biryani is delicious. It’s filled with local spices, juicy meat, and fluffy rice. Dining at Hotel Shadab feels special because it’s in the old part of the city. It’s nostalgic and, perhaps, a bit romantic. Located in the heart of Hyderabad at Basheer Bagh, Cafe Bahar is one of the most popular and loved biryani places in the city. Renowned for its authentic Hyderabadi dum biryani, the place has been a foodie’s paradise since 1973. The place remains a crowd favourite for its no-frills ambience, generous portions, and consistent taste!

This place is not your usual biryani restaurant; it’s known more for its Andhra-style meals. But their Ulavacharu Chicken Biryani is a hidden gem that people wish to taste. The biryani here has a spicier flavour due to the use of Andhra masalas, which gives it a tangy and punchy twist. It’s definitely different from regular Hyderabadi biryani but equally satisfying. If you are adventurous and want to try something new, this is a great pick. It might just surprise you as the best biryani in Hyderabad for spice lovers.

With multiple outlets citywide, Pista House is a household name, also famous for its haleem during Ramadan. Most people know Pista House for its Haleem, but their biryani is good as well. The meat is tender, and the biryani isn’t too spicy; it’s just right for most people. If you’re near Charminar, this is a great choice for a hearty lunch or dinner. The place can get crowded, especially near Charminar, but the food is worth it.

If you want to enjoy biryani at a nice restaurant, Dum Pukht Begum’s is the place to go in Hyderabad. Located in the elegant ITC Kohenur, the art of dum biryani reaches a royal level here. The chefs slow-cook fragrant basmati rice and marinated meat in a sealed handi. This method lets the flavours develop and blend under a thin layer of dough. The outcome is a subtly spiced, richly aromatic, and very tender biryani.

Compared to the older restaurants in the city, Biryaniwalla & Co. feels modern and clean. Their service is quick, the seating is comfortable, and the food isn’t too oily or spicy. Their chicken and mutton biryanis have rich flavours and a great balance. People also love their vegetarian Paneer Biryani, which stands out for its authentic taste. It’s a quiet place for lunch or dinner, especially if you want to enjoy biryani in a relaxed atmosphere.
